Deploying massive solar capital requires securing components with low logistical overhead and absolute material reliability. China's solar cluster offers strategic integration advantages.
By centering our operations in Anhui's high-tech industrial manufacturing belt, we draw direct connections to raw material hubs. From high-purity silicon processing and float glass tempering to structural aluminum extrusion, our zero-mile logistics reduce component lead times and guarantee structural integrity.
Our 7.5 GW automated lines leverage manufacturing economies of scale. High-throughput automation lowers labor costs, while inline AI-driven visual scanners detect micro-cracks before lamination, reducing field failure rates in utility projects.
Our direct access to major maritime corridors like Ningbo and Shanghai ports enables rapid global shipping. We offer customized packaging to protect glass-to-glass BIPV roof tiles and large mounting brackets during transport, reducing shipping damages.

Our products have achieved certifications for Quality Management System (ISO 9001:2015), Environmental Management System (ISO 14001:2015), and Occupational Health and Safety Management System (ISO 45001:2018) from both DNV GL and GZCC, reflecting our commitment to excellence, sustainability, and workplace safety.
Furthermore, to ensure seamless integration into international electrical systems, our hardware complies with grid connection and safety standards globally, including CE, TUV, IEC 61215, IEC 61730, and UL certifications, alongside local utility grid codes across North America, Europe, and Asia-Pacific.

For urban properties, integrating glass-to-glass BIPV tiles (like our Vbsolar 30W and 87W Red tiles) allows homeowners to replace traditional clay or slate tiles with power-generating surfaces. This preserves building aesthetics while generating local clean energy.
Corporate campuses and commercial plazas utilize our Ground Mount PV carport mounting structures. This design shades parked vehicles while generating clean energy to offset building load or power local EV charging stations.
Large utility arrays in high-soiling areas (such as deserts or near coastal zones) utilize our automated and remote-controlled PV panel cleaning robots. Regular automated cleaning cycles maintain module albedo and prevent hot-spot degradation.
